Serialize and Deserialize Binary Tree

Design reversible serialization and deserialization for a binary tree.

hardcodingEvidence 80/1002 source reportsNVIDIATikTok

The 60-second answer

Use preorder traversal with explicit null markers, or level-order traversal with null placeholders. Target O(n) time and O(n) serialized space.

Senior-level signal

  • Define a grammar/version for the wire format rather than relying on ad-hoc splitting.
  • Discuss backward compatibility and validation if the format becomes persistent data.
